Abstract
INTRODUCTION: Radiographic descriptions of gout have noted the tendency to hypertrophic bone changes. The aim of this study was to characterize the features of new bone formation (NBF) in gout, and to determine the relationship between NBF and other radiographic features of disease, particularly erosion and tophus.Entities:

Features of new bone formation (NBF) in patients with gout.
| Number of joints with XR NBF features (number = 798 joints) | Mean (SD) number of joints with XR NBF features (number = 20 patients) | Number of joints with CT NBF features (number = 798 joints) | Mean (SD) number of joints with CT NBF features (number = 20 patients)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Spur | 76 (9.5%) | 3.8 (5.7) | 141 (17.6%) | 7.1 (7.9) |
| Osteophyte | 167 (20.9%) | 8.4 (6.5) | 243 (30.5%) | 12.2 (7.7) |
| Periosteal NBF | 51 (6.4%) | 2.6 (3.4) | 48 (6.0%) | 2.4 (3.4) |
| Ankylosis | 7 (0.9%) | 0.35 (1.1) | 5 (0.6%) | 0.25 (3.4) |
| Sclerosis | 207 (25.9%) | 10.4 (8.9) | 228 (28.6%) | 11.4 (8.3) |
CT, computed tomography; SD, standard deviation; XR, plain radiography.
